After five months: Rafah Crossing opens for exit from the Gaza Strip
August 17, 2017. Earlier this week, Egypt began allowing pilgrims to exit Gaza via Rafah Crossing, en route to Mecca. Yesterday, travel was also allowed for people who meet other criteria. The Gaza power plant has again reduced production of electricity.
Rafah Crossing has been closed for five months; longest period in the last decade
August 8, 2017. There are approximately thirty thousand people on the waiting list to exit from Gaza to Egypt.
New directive at Erez Crossing: Palestinians cannot exit with food, toiletries or electronic devices
August 2, 2017. Intake coordinators at Gisha received an email detailing new guidelines for passage through Erez Crossing. The instructions have not been published anywhere official and will encumber those passing, with no clear purpose.
